    Abstract: Systems and methods are described herein for providing power for enabling electroluminescence imaging of photovoltaic panels. The system may comprise a diode in a power converter, where the diode may restrict reverse current flow to the photovoltaic panel. The system may comprise a power device configured to be coupled to a photovoltaic panel. The power device may comprise an auxiliary power circuit which may provide power to the power device from the photovoltaic panel or form a power source connected to a power system controller. The power device may control a switch to provide a current path for reverse current to flow to the photovoltaic panel. An imager may capture an image of the panel.

    Abstract: A switching circuit may comprise first and second switch legs and a coupled inductor. The controller may operate the first and second switch legs to control a current flowing through the coupled inductor such that zero voltage switching (ZVS) may be applied to the first and second switch legs. The system may determine a switching event time of a switch in the first switch leg, and determine a switching node voltage rise event time of the first switch leg based on a voltage measured at a switching node of the first switch leg. The controller may drive one or more switches using PWM signals. For example, the controller may drive one or more switches based on determining, for a switching instance, a phase difference between a first PWM signal and a second PWM signal for generating a ripple current for ZVS.
